Output 8506104ce89906828819ae98af2316baf2522adde353e93168a683909a2965e4:0

value
831237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d67a0a3e2fc0087ec43567661e375f7c2586aa OP_EQUAL
address
3KufKpcPQ9bmmwWAJy8urA8WZCajVR2QtQ
transaction
8506104ce89906828819ae98af2316baf2522adde353e93168a683909a2965e4
confirmations
153065
spent
true